Preferred label Iberian sage-leaved willow scrub
Definition Small or medium-sized willow scrub of meso-Mediterranean and, locally, supra-Mediterranean, zones of central Iberia (Castellano-Leonese sectors, Extremadura), characterized by the presence of the Iberian endemic [Salix salvifolia] and [Salix x secalliana], together with [Salix atrocinerea], [Salix x matritensis], [Salix neotricha], [Salix purpurea ssp. lambertiana], [Salix triandra ssp. discolor]; they line, mostly on siliceous sandy soils, small oligotrophic rivers with strong seasonal amplitude, or form behind the taller curtain of the [Populo nigrae-Salicetum neotrichae] along large water courses of argilous base-rich soils.
